I see you're from Ohio. There is a species of vulture that has been extending it's range into Ohio, generally coming in from the south. It's known as the Black Vulture, and it is an active predator. There are documented reports of groups of them attacking and killing newborn calves, I think baby chicks would be a no-brainer for them.
